This was a 7th grade girlÂ’s basketball game. The ball was thrown in bounds under the basket in the back court (no defenders nearby). The player after taking a few dribbles somehow lost the ball and it started to rollout of bounds. Before the ball was out of bounds her coach called time out and my partner granted the time out. The opposing coach complained saying that she has to have possession before a time out can be granted. What is the ruling on this and where would I find it in the rules book?

Thanks

A1 must have player control of the ball at the time that Coach A requests a timeout.
